首页 | 本学科首页   官方微博 | 高级检索  
     


Flat Concurrent Prolog on transputers
Affiliation:1. Division of Computational Mechatronics, Institute for Computational Science, Ton Duc Thang University, Ho Chi Minh City, Viet Nam;2. Faculty of Electrical & Electronics Engineering, Ton Duc Thang University, Ho Chi Minh City, Viet Nam;3. Faculty of Automobile Technology, Hanoi University of Industry, Viet Nam;4. School of Engineering, Faculty of Science and Engineering, University of Wolverhampton, United Kingdom;1. School of Civil Engineering, Hefei University of Technology, Hefei 230009, China;2. Anhui International Joint Research Center on Hydrogen Safety, Hefei 230009, China;1. Division of Neurorehabilitation, Department of Clinical Neurosciences, Geneva University Hospitals, Switzerland;2. Laboratory of Cognitive Neurorehabilitation, Department of Clinical Neurosciences, Medical School, University of Geneva, Geneva, Switzerland;3. Faculty of Psychology and Educational Sciences, University of Geneva, Geneva, Switzerland;1. St Vincent’s Hospital, Victoria, Australia;2. Department of Medicine, University of Melbourne, Victoria, Australia
Abstract:Flat Concurrent Prolog (FCP) is a general purpose logic programming language designed for concurrent programming and parallel execution. Staring with a concise introduction of the language and its underlying computational model we describe how to implement a distributed FCP interpreter on a transputer environment using OCCAM. Basic techniques we used for exploiting and controlling parallelism are explained in terms of an abstract architecture. The result of mapping this abstract model on transputers is presented as concrete architecture. Substantial design issues are considered in detail.
Keywords:
本文献已被 ScienceDirect 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号